About St. David, Illinois

St. David is a locality in Fulton County, Illinois, United States. It is a small community with a population of 383. The population density is 255.9 people per km². St. David is located at 40.4934°N, 90.0487°W. It observes the Central Time (America/Chicago) timezone. ZIP code: 61563.

The story of St. David is deeply entwined with the earth beneath it, a history etched by the veins of coal that once fueled its prosperity. This was a mining town, its very existence shaped by the arduous work of bringing forth the black, glittering heart of the land. Though the mines have long since fallen silent, the legacy of that industry lingers, a subtle undercurrent in the town's character, a quiet resilience born of shared hardship and labor. The local economy now leans more towards agriculture, the surrounding fields yielding their bounty of corn and soybeans, a gentler rhythm replacing the clatter and roar of the past.
